LI is more water-cooler than BB. It exploded last year and now almost everybody I know talks about it, most my friends/colleagues watch it and I've heard teenagers talking about it at school. It's like how everyone used to talk about BB ten years ago. I also agree that it gets a much better social media following, things like having a Snapchat filter for promotion helps massively and I think LI appeals to the younger audience much better than BB does, whereas the main demographic for BB nowadays are the cat ladies.

And on top of that, LI is the much slicker and better-produced show out of the two. They put much more effort in and the growing ratings reflect that, the same can't be said for BB anymore sadly.
